If i leave my pc on overnight downloading, encrypyting, or
even if i leave it when im out the house and its idling, i
come back and my display is set back to 16bit colours in
640x480 with an error msg
"windows has recovered from a serious error,please save
all work and reboot"
the message is possibly longer.
Im not sure but i think it may be related to the graphics
card or its drivers,but on the other hand i have only
noticed this problem since i have installed windows xp
home.
my system spec:
AMD XP 2000+ - running @ 1.9ghz
Asus mobo A7nx i think
512mb pc2100 ddr ram
Creative sound blaster lives 5.1 digital sound card
Modular geforce 4 mx 440 128mb (was given to me free so
could'nt complain really )
Scsi ide card with x2 seagate 80gb h/d's on primary channel
x1 40 gb maxtor hd
x1 40 gb seagate h/d
IBC DVD writer
Memorex cd - rw
My pc is modded, fans cold cathodes etc, unsure if it is a
power realted problem or if it is related to my graphics
card.

> AMD XP 2000+ - running @ 1.9ghz
Looks like you've overclocked the CPU somewhat from its normal 1.67GHz.
This may be the main cause of your problem.
> Asus mobo A7nx i think
Your problems seem to be more "hardware" than "windowsxp.hardware". My
guess is that they don't relate to Windows at all, but to your
mobo/CPU/graphics... Your best bet might be the Usenet newsgroup:
alt.comp.periphs.mainboard.asus
When I have problems with my EPoX mobo, I try the EPoX newsgroup. The gurus
there are much more likely to be able to solve this kind of hardware
problem.
